Output d8807356aba44e79fe7b93e234de8ee048865adf331f1f2bf83f68b4106c7b6e:0

value
612990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5269e112cb45060fcbdde6d5afb462278ea67376 OP_EQUALVERIFY OP_CHECKSIG
address
18WmFM2usjnVdt8wbuXyBu2eZe3p54Swvb
transaction
d8807356aba44e79fe7b93e234de8ee048865adf331f1f2bf83f68b4106c7b6e
spent
true